1. The Fundamental Principle: How Axial fans ventilation Achieve Linear Airflow
The axial fan is the most ubiquitous form of air-moving machinery, defined by its core operating principle: moving gas parallel to the axis of the rotating shaft[1]. Unlike centrifugal fans, which move air radially (at a 90-degree angle), axial fans draw air in and discharge it in a straight line, making them ideal for high-volume, low-pressure applications[2][3]. This linear flow is achieved through the aerodynamic design of the fan blades, which function similarly to an airplane's wing or propeller[4]. As the motor drives the hub and the attached blades to rotate, the airfoil shape of each blade creates a pressure differential[2]. The convex (curved) side of the blade experiences lower pressure, while the concave (flatter) side experiences higher pressure. This pressure difference generates an aerodynamic lift force, and because the blades are angled, this lift force is primarily directed parallel to the axis of rotation[5]. This action imparts kinetic energy to the air, accelerating it forward[2]. The velocity of the exiting air is high, but the pressure increase is typically moderate, positioning axial fans ventilation as perfect solutions for applications where air needs to be moved quickly across short distances or through minimal resistance, such as general room ventilation or cooling an engine radiator[6][7]. The simplicity of this design—a motor, a hub, and a set of blades—contributes to the fan's compact size and cost-effectiveness, cementing its role as the workhorse of air movement in both industrial and commercial settings[8].
2. The Essential Role of Axial Fans in HVAC Systems
Axial fans form the silent, yet essential, backbone of countless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ning (HVAC) systems globally[9]. Their primary function in these systems is the efficient circulation of conditioned air and the maintenance of indoor air quality[9]. Within a commercial HVAC unit, such as an air handler, an axial fan is frequently tasked with drawing ambient air across condenser coils or pushing air into a short duct run for distribution. Their high-volume flow rate is critical for these processes, as large quantities of air must be processed quickly to regulate temperatures across expansive buildings[6]. For instance, rooftop HVAC units commonly employ propeller-style axial fans to move massive amounts of air across the heat exchange components to facilitate the refrigeration cycle[9]. They are particularly effective in HVAC applications because the air resistance (static pressure) within typical residential or commercial ductwork is often low, a condition where axial fans exhibit maximum efficiency[10]. Furthermore, larger axial units are extensively used in building exhaust systems, quickly moving stale air, smoke, or fumes out of industrial or commercial spaces[11]. This ability to manage bulk air movement with relatively low power consumption makes them an indispensable, energy-efficient component for creating comfortable and safe indoor environments, from office buildings to shopping centers and residential housing[12].
